Output 462369687711e5e172d62f3e8ad2d45d446efe7376f55a0f766e581f7fd35f1a:50

value
43978
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e6330677e17b444c569785b137ee6ad8c083c302 OP_EQUAL
address
3NgCTxmtYL8j95sxqmXbLkKRVC4u3Xh2t8
transaction
462369687711e5e172d62f3e8ad2d45d446efe7376f55a0f766e581f7fd35f1a
spent
true